Apart from behavior, this is impossible to tell in-game as both Neutral and Hostile IFFs appear red on the HUD. Note however, that Neutral ships will not attack Hostile ships unless specifically ordered to, in keeping with the HoL's non-resistance belief when it comes to Shivans. The Shivans were assigned the Hostile IFF, which allows the two sides to engage each other.
